Avatar billede jensb Nybegynder
17. december 2006 - 09:38 Der er 11 kommentarer og
1 løsning

Access bruges allerede af et andet program

Hej

Jeg sidder og roder lidt med at sende og modtage SMS-beskeder via en hjemmeside lavet i ASP.

Jeg bruger dette program http://www.gsmsoft.nu/html/engmermmessenger.html
til at sende SMS'er. Via ASP laver jeg en .txt fil som gemmes i en outbox, og Mobile Messenger sender så alle disse txt filer som SMS. Ingen problemer her.

Men jeg vil også gerne kunne modtage SMS'er. Og her har jeg så fundet ud af, at Mobile Messenger automatisk gemmer alle indkomne beskeder i en Access database. Jeg kan sådan set også godt finde ud af at læse SMS'erne fra denne access database, via ASP. Problemet er, at når Mobile Messenger programmet kører, så kan jeg ikke få adgang til at læse fra databasen med ASP.

Jeg har så forsøgt at linke tabellen over i en anden access database, og så læse fra denne. Men samme problem. Jeg kan ikke få lov til at læse via ASP, sålænge Mobile Messenger kører.

Findes der et eller andet trick jeg kan bruge?

Jeg vil smutte ud og få købt lidt julegaver, så jeg svarer ikke de næste par timer. Men på forhånd tak for hjælpen.
Avatar billede terry Ekspert
17. december 2006 - 10:46 #1
It is very likley that the database is opened Exclusively (one user only allowed) by m.m. and as far as I know there is no trick which will allow it.
Avatar billede kalp Novice
17. december 2006 - 10:48 #2
skifte db?
Avatar billede terry Ekspert
17. december 2006 - 10:48 #3
Cant you decide when m.m must run? and if so, you can also decide when to read from the database
Avatar billede terry Ekspert
17. december 2006 - 10:52 #4
Why dont you contact info@gsmsoft.nu and see what they have to say-
Avatar billede jensb Nybegynder
17. december 2006 - 13:48 #5
Mobile Messenger skal køre 24x7x365

Til at starte med havde jeg ikke opdaget at Mobile Messenger gemte i access. Så jeg kontakte GSMsoft og spurgte om der kunne blive implementeret en funktion som gemte indkomne beskeder i en .txt. Det var så GSMsoft der svarede tilbage og forklarede, at indkomne beskeder faktisk blev gemt i en access database, som jeg så kunne trække dem fra. Men det kunne jo så desværre ikke lade sig gøre, og jeg har så også kontaktet GSMsoft igen, men de har ikke efterfølgende svaret.

Nå, men der findes heldigvis massere SMS programmer, så jeg tror bare jeg prøver at finde et andet SMS programmer.

Tak for hjælpen.
Avatar billede terry Ekspert
17. december 2006 - 14:13 #6
"Mobile Messenger skal køre 24x7x365"
Does it run as a service? I wouldnt think it has the database open Exclusive 24x7x365 though, only when it writes to the dB. So I would have thought that there would be periods when you could open it. Have you tried making a copy of the dB and then open the copy?
Avatar billede jensb Nybegynder
17. december 2006 - 14:43 #7
"Does it run as a service?"
Det ved jeg ikke?.

Det virker som om at Mobile Messenger har databasen åben hele tiden, og ikke kun når den skriver. Jeg kan godt åbne selve databasen i Access, selvom Mobile Messenger kører. Men jeg kan ikke få lov til at connecte via ASP, sålænge Mobile Messenger kører.

Jeg går ud fra at jeg sagtens vil kunne lave en kopi af databasen, og så åbne denne. Men kopien vil jo så ikke være fuldt opdateret.
Avatar billede terry Ekspert
17. december 2006 - 14:48 #8
If you can open it with Access then I'm puzzled as to why you cant open it using ASP. Cant help you with ASP code though, I dont know enough about ASP :o(
Avatar billede jensb Nybegynder
17. december 2006 - 15:06 #9
Ja det virker underligt.

Men tak for hjælpen.
Avatar billede terry Ekspert
17. december 2006 - 15:08 #10
selv tak, hope you find a solution
Avatar billede jensb Nybegynder
17. december 2006 - 15:23 #11
Det gjorde jeg så. Faldt lige over denne side : http://support.microsoft.com/kb/174943

Det var altså bare et problem med rettigheder på mappen hvor den originale Mobile Messenger database ligger.

Jg forstår så stadig ikke hvordan jeg har kunne connecte når bare Mobile Messenger ikke kørte. Men hvad, det ser ud til at virke nu.
Avatar billede terry Ekspert
17. december 2006 - 15:26 #12
Super :o)
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Dyk ned i databasernes verden på et af vores praksisnære Access-kurser

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ester